Willughby, Francis; RAY, John (editor).
The Ornithology of Francis Willughby
of Middleton in the county of Warwick Esq; fellow of the Royal Society. In three books. Wherein all the birds hitherto known, being reduced into a method sutable to their natures, are accurately described. The descriptions illustrated by most elegant figu

London, printed by A[ndrew]. C[larke]. for John Martyn, printer to the Royal Society, at the Bell in St. Pauls Church-Yard, 1678

Description
First edition in English. Folio (39 x 25 cm); [12], 53, [3], 55-271, [3], 273-441, [7] pp., 80 engraved plates comprising 78 plates of birds showing multiple subjects numbered 1-LXXVIII, and 2 un-numbered plates of netting, bookplate, some minor tears to a few pages; occasional light soiling, contemporary calf, neat restoration to edges and extremities, a very good copy.
Bibliography
Keynes, Ray 39; Nissen IVB 991, Norman II, 1792; Wing W 2880.
